Tharhiauha Population - Basti, Uttar Pradesh

Tharhiauha is a medium size village located in Harraiya Tehsil of Basti district, Uttar Pradesh with total 72 families residing. The Tharhiauha village has population of 576 of which 306 are males while 270 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Tharhiauha village population of children with age 0-6 is 103 which makes up 17.88 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Tharhiauha village is 882 which is lower than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Tharhiauha as per census is 943, higher than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.

Tharhiauha village has lower liter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Tharhiauha village was 61.31 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Tharhiauha Male literacy stands at 68.38 % while female literacy rate was 53.18 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 14.93 % of total population in Tharhiauha village. The village Tharhiauha curr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Tharhiauha village out of total population, 313 were engaged in work activities. 98.72 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 1.28 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 313 workers engaged in Main Work, 107 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 58 were Agricultural labourer.
